Next.js #부스트캠프 #학습정리1 [학습정리] Next.js를 프로젝트에서 사용한 이유 학습정리 : Next.js 이 문서는 Next를 처음 공부하면서 작성한 글로 잘못된 정보가 있을 수 있습니다. Next.js란? Next.js는 React로 만드는 서버사이드 렌더링 프레임 워크이다. 서버사이드 렌더링을 하면 뭐가 좋은데? 클라이언트 렌더링의 경우 모든 js 파일을 로드하고 사용자는 웹을 보게 된다. 이때까지 사용자는 많은 시간을 대기해야한다.(첫 로딩 시간이 오래 걸린다.) seo 클라이언트 사이드의 경우 자바스크립트가 로드 되지 않은 경우 아무런 정보를 볼 수 없다. 검색엔진의 봇에 아무 페이지도 걸리지 않아, seo에 불리하다. 이런 두가지 문제점을 해결하는 것이 서버 사이드 렌더링이다. 해결 서버에서 자바스크립트를 로딩함으로 클라이언트 측에서는 자바스크립트를 로딩하는 시간이 줄어든.. 2022. 12. 3. 이전 1 다음